Lebanon, Ohio at a Glance
Lebanon is a city in Lebanon city, Ohio with a population of approximately 20,999. The median home value is $247,300 and the median household income is $75,665. It has a Walk Score of 0 out of 100, indicating car dependency. The violent crime rate is 1.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 61% below the national average. Air quality is rated Good. The overall climate risk is rated as "Very Low." Median rent is $888 per month. Data sourced from the US Census Bureau, FBI Crime Data Explorer, EPA, Walk Score, and FEMA.

Culture & Things to Do in Lebanon
Lebanon Country Applefest
A large annual festival celebrating apples with crafts, food, and entertainment.
Lebanon Blues Festival
A weekend-long festival featuring blues music performances.
Warren County Fair
A traditional county fair with agricultural exhibits, rides, and entertainment.
Christmas in Lebanon
Annual holiday celebrations including a tree lighting and parade.
